Wasatch County lies in north-central Utah and is celebrated for its mountain scenery, ski resorts, and tranquil valley living. The county seat, Heber City, anchors the Heber Valley, surrounded by the Wasatch Mountains and Jordanelle Reservoir. Founded in 1862, the county grew from a farming settlement into one of Utah’s premier recreation and second-home regions. Its towns—Heber City, Midway, and Charleston—combine Swiss-style charm with modern amenities. Midway hosts the annual Swiss Days festival, while Heber City boasts a heritage railroad and quick access to Park City’s ski slopes. Housing varies from cozy mountain cabins and ranch properties to luxury estates in gated golf communities like Red Ledges. Average home prices range $750 K – $1.1 M, with high-end builds costing $300 – $450 per sq ft. The area attracts retirees, professionals, and outdoor enthusiasts who value scenic living within 45 minutes of Salt Lake City.
